在当今的网络环境中,IPv6正逐渐成为主流。为了确保您能顺畅使用网络服务,了解如何配置Shadowsocks以支持IPv6是十分必要的。本文将为您提供一个详细的指南,帮助您实现这一目标。
什么是Shadowsocks?
Shadowsocks是一款开源的代理工具,主要用于突破网络封锁和隐私保护。它通过将流量加密后转发到中间服务器,实现对被封锁网站的访问。
为什么选择IPv6?
随着IPv4地址的日益枯竭,IPv6应运而生,具有以下优势:
- 更多的地址空间:提供了几乎无限的IP地址。
- 简化的网络配置:可以简化网络设备的配置和管理。
- 内建的安全特性:IPv6具有更高的安全性,可以更好地保护用户隐私。
配置Shadowsocks支持IPv6的步骤
1. 确保系统支持IPv6
在开始配置之前,确保您的操作系统和网络环境支持IPv6。可以通过以下方式检查:
- 使用命令行输入
ping -6 google.com
,查看是否能成功ping通。 - 检查网络配置,确保IPv6地址已经分配。
2. 下载和安装Shadowsocks
从官方GitHub页面下载适合您操作系统的Shadowsocks客户端,并进行安装。可以根据以下步骤进行安装:
- Windows:下载*.exe*文件并双击运行。
- Linux:使用包管理工具安装,例如
apt install shadowsocks
。 - Mac:通过Homebrew安装,命令为
brew install shadowsocks
。
3. 配置Shadowsocks
打开Shadowsocks客户端,进入配置界面,您需要设置以下信息:
- 服务器地址:输入支持IPv6的服务器地址。
- 端口号:填写相应的端口号。
- 密码:设置用于连接的密码。
- 加密方式:选择合适的加密方式,建议使用AEAD系列。
确保您在服务器配置中也启用了IPv6支持。
4. 启动Shadowsocks
完成配置后,点击“启动”按钮,Shadowsocks将会建立连接。检查状态是否显示为“已连接”。
5. 测试连接
您可以通过访问IPv6支持的网站,例如https://test-ipv6.com
,测试您的IPv6连接是否正常。
常见问题解答
Q1: Shadowsocks支持IPv6吗?
回答:是的,Shadowsocks支持IPv6,只需确保您的客户端和服务器均已配置支持IPv6。
Q2: 如何检查我的IPv6地址?
回答:您可以通过命令行输入 ipconfig
(Windows) 或 ifconfig
(Linux/Mac) 来查看分配的IPv6地址。
Q3: 我应该选择哪个加密方式?
回答:建议选择AEAD系列的加密方式,因为它们提供了更好的性能和安全性。
Q4: 如果无法连接怎么办?
回答:请检查以下几点:
- 确保服务器地址和端口号填写正确。
- 确保您的网络支持IPv6。
- 检查您的防火墙设置,确保没有阻止相关流量。
小结
配置Shadowsocks以支持IPv6并不复杂,按照本文的步骤操作即可。通过使用Shadowsocks,您不仅可以突破网络封锁,还能享受到更快速、更安全的上网体验。希望本篇文章对您有所帮助!
正文完